We investigate the stability of a straight vortex tube of constant vorticity in the presence of external shearing and straining flows orthogonal to the axis of the vortex tube. We find that the tube is unstable at degenerate wavenumbers (i.e., wavenumbers at which two Kelvin wavemodes have the same frequency). The maximum growth rate of the instability is weighted by the sum of the shear magnitude and the strain magnitude. The presence of the shear also shifts the wavenumber of the instability. © 1998 American Institute of Physics.
